<div></div>I supply poisons on the ma<font color="#ffffff">rket here in Freeport of the T5 kind daily.</font><font color="#ffffff"> </font><font color="#ffffff"> </font><font color="#ffffff">I'm the only person really doing this (occasionally some newb T2 alchemist will put some on the market for 1s less than mine and try to rip people off, but that doesn't count) and it's really not worth it.</font><font color="#ffffff"> </font> <font color="#ffffff"> </font><font color="#ff0000"> Making the poison vials is a pain in the butt</font><font color="#ffffff"> (2x T5 coals to make the darn things using the Apothecary books)</font><font color="#ffffff"> </font> <font color="#ffffff"> </font><font color="#ff3300"> The quality it dependent on quality of the vial</font> (jeweler specialty), not of the mixture (alchemy specialty, what genius thought that up?) <font color="#ff3300"> You can't give them away</font> (1g25s for a T5 Translucent (7 charges), and 1g for T5 normal (6).  They almost never sell. Any less and I'd almost be losing money) <font color="#ff3300"> They don't work</font> (resisted oh so often it's almost a waste of money) <font color="#ff3300"> They don't con correctly</font> (they're grey by the 6th level in the tier, giving the impression they're useless) <font color="#ff3300"> They are troublesome to make </font>(yes, at 50 it's all too easy to fail the level 43 recipe for Disruptive Torment and get 'normal') <font color="#ff3300"> They're bugged</font> (Some are potions in disguise, the rare ones don't always do anything, and some have 1 charge which seems to be always resisted) <font color="#ff3300"> Nobody cares</font> (NPC poisons are a fraction of the cost and have 5 charges) *edit a few typo's <div></div><p>Message Edited by GodH8sMe on <span class=date_text>03-30-2005</span> <span class=time_text>09:58 PM</span>

<P>I prefer player crafted most of the time when i can get them. I usually keep 3-4 colors going at any given time and at 26 I know that I'd rather have Tier IV posion dumbed down to my level than grey Tier III or NPC bought (lvl 20 so also grey). That is the nice thing about player made is that you can use any level you want...it just adjusts to you.</P> <P> </P> <P>As far as pricing goes...I'll pay what I can afford and at my level I usually buy them for around 25-30s each. A great investment in my book because each vial will last me about a week so I invest 1-1.5G/week in poisons, and about the same in arrows. But with the combo I get to solo heroic green and blue ^^ and live so it is worth it.</P>

With respect to the cost of player crafted T5 poisons:Combines:1) ashen roots + aerated mineral water + beeswax candle = 4 pristine golgi oil (9s28c total, 2s32c each)2) teak or ashen roots + aerated mineral water + beeswax candle = 4 pristine golgi resin (9s28c total, 2s32c each)3) diamondine or bloodstone + golgi oil + beeswax candle = enneanoid reagent + enneanoid loam (9s22c) - sellback on the enneanoid reagent is 13s22c, cost to produce -4s4) enneanoid loam + 2 lustrous black coal = 3 x unblemished superb poison vial (18s44c total, 6s15c each)5) unblemished superb poison vial + supernal suspension + golgi resin + beeswax candle = Translucent Hypnotic Shock (7 / 7 charges) (18s44c)Combine 1 is 2s32cCombine 2 is 2s32cCombine 3 is -4sc (with sellback of enneanoid reagent)Combine 4 is 6s15cCombine 5 is 18s44cTotal Player-Created cost is 25s23c (7 charges) with sellbacks and multiple-item combines. That's 3s60c per dose. At 200 procs per dose, that's the equivalent of 1s80c per T5 player made damage+dot "normal" poison.T5 NPC Alchemist Vendor sells 200 skill poison for 30s72c (5 charges), that's 6s14c per dose, at 100 procs per dose.<pre>NPC made: 30s72c per 5 doses. 6s14c per dose. PC made: 25s23c per 7 doses. 3s60c per dose.NPC made: 6s14c per 100-procs. PC made: 1s80c per 100-procs.</pre><p>Message Edited by agra on <span class=date_text>04-08-2005</span> <span class=time_text>10:08 AM</span>
